Aggregate conveying is a critical process in construction and industrial applications, involving the movement of materials like gravel, sand, and crushed stone from one location to another. The efficiency and reliability of the conveying system directly impact project timelines and operational costs. Various methods have been developed to address different scenarios, from small-scale projects to large-scale industrial operations.
Belt Conveyors for Aggregate Transport

Belt conveyors are one of the most widely used methods for aggregate conveying. They consist of a continuous belt that moves over rollers or pulleys, transporting materials in a linear path. This method is particularly effective for long-distance transport and can handle a wide range of aggregate sizes. The design allows for easy integration with other equipment, such as crushers and screens, making it a versatile solution. Belt conveyors are known for their high capacity and low maintenance requirements, which contribute to their popularity in the industry.
Screw Conveyors for Bulk Material Handling

Screw conveyors, also known as auger conveyors, use a rotating screw to move materials along a tube or trough. This method is ideal for vertical or inclined transport, as well as horizontal movement. Screw conveyors are suitable for handling fine or powdery aggregates, and they can be customized to fit specific space constraints. The enclosed design helps prevent material spillage and contamination, which is crucial for maintaining product quality. These conveyors are often used in processing plants where precise material control is necessary.
Pneumatic Conveying Systems
Pneumatic conveying systems use air pressure to transport aggregates through a pipeline. This method is particularly useful for transporting materials over short to medium distances, especially in environments where dust control is a concern. The system can handle a variety of aggregate types, including dry and wet materials. Pneumatic conveyors are known for their flexibility, as they can be easily reconfigured to change the transport route. However, they require careful design to ensure efficient air flow and prevent material blockages.
Hydraulic Conveying Methods

Hydraulic conveyors use water or other fluids to transport aggregates, typically in a slurry form. This method is commonly used in mining and quarry operations where large volumes of material need to be moved over long distances. Hydraulic systems are capable of handling very high capacities and can operate in challenging terrains. The main advantage is the ability to transport materials through pipelines without the need for mechanical parts, reducing wear and tear. However, they require significant water resources and may not be suitable for all aggregate types.
Gravity Conveyors and Chutes
Gravity conveyors utilize the force of gravity to move aggregates down a sloped path. This method is simple and cost-effective, especially for short vertical or horizontal distances. Chutes are often used in conjunction with gravity systems to direct the flow of materials. Gravity conveyors are ideal for applications where the material is already at a higher elevation or where minimal energy input is desired. They are commonly used in stockpiling operations and for moving materials from storage bins to processing equipment.
